Acute bone marrow necrosis caused by streptococcal infection

Summary
A severe streptococcal infection mimicked acute leukemia in an 8-year-old boy. Prompt antibiotic treatment led to a full recovery, highlighting the importance of considering infections in pediatric differential diagnoses.
Area of Science:
- Pediatric Infectious Diseases
- Hematology
- Microbiology
Background:
- Acute leukemia is a serious diagnosis in children, characterized by abnormal white blood cell proliferation.
- Differential diagnosis is crucial, especially when presenting symptoms overlap with severe infections.
- Fever, hepatosplenomegaly, leukopenia, and thrombocytopenia can be indicative of both malignancy and infection.
Observation:
- An 8-year-old boy presented with a foot furuncle, high fever, severe knee pain, and hematologic abnormalities (leukopenia, thrombocytopenia), initially suspected as acute leukemia.
- Bone marrow aspirate revealed necrotic cells and Streptococcus clusters, not leukemic cells.
- Clinical signs included slight hepatosplenomegaly.
Findings:
- Microscopic examination of bone marrow aspirate identified Streptococcus clusters and necrotic cells.
- The patient's condition was attributed to a severe streptococcal infection, not acute leukemia.
- Leukopenia and thrombocytopenia resolved after treatment.
Implications:
- This case underscores the critical need to consider and rule out severe bacterial infections in pediatric patients presenting with leukemia-like symptoms.
- Early identification of infectious etiologies, like streptococcal bacteremia, is vital for appropriate and timely treatment.
- Antibiotic therapy proved effective, leading to complete clinical recovery and resolution of hematologic abnormalities.
